Output ff57a056658ab69517bec4fb96e2987c03db5275d65bd22c95cceb8ee7217b0e:0

value
530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c895b3c00ec5d54add261443279701fe3320a96 OP_EQUAL
address
3EW7567Lgzdt3Sq6Z2RRNK9rD5717xeqsd
transaction
ff57a056658ab69517bec4fb96e2987c03db5275d65bd22c95cceb8ee7217b0e
spent
true